Northern Yankees join SBL season

The Northern Yankees became the last minute addition to the competing teams in the 2015 Saipan Baseball League, which is set to open next week at the Francisco M. “Tan Ko” Palacios Baseball Field.

The Yankees’ inclusion brings to seven the squads that will vie for the SBL title, which will be defended by Brewers

The Yankees, with Saipan Stevedore as their sponsor, won the pennant but lost the 2014 finals to the Brewers, who will now be managed by Joey Dela Cruz. Dela Cruz took over the spot of longtime manager Tony Rogolifoi, who decided to step down to concentrate on running the SBL and his work as Northern Marianas Sports Association’s executive director.

The Fielders of Pat Tenorio, North Starz of Jon Tenorio, Franco Flores’ A’s, Froilan Camacho’s Jets, and the Doru Camacho-handled Falcons are the other competing teams. Raena Camacho is the Yankees manager.

Rogolifoi has also revised the entire schedule for the season after the Yankees’ inclusion, but the opening match on Jan. 12, Monday, will still be between the Brewers and the Fielders.

The North Starz play against the A’s on Jan. 14, Wednesday, and the Jets take on the Falcons on Jan. 16, Friday, while the Yankees make their debut against the North Starz on Jan. 19.

Rogolifoi is reminding all teams to submit their 25-member rosters for verification and statistical purposes this week along with the $1,000 entrance fee.

Rogolifoi is also requesting all managers and coaches to attend the Jan. 7 final meeting at 5:30pm at the Gilbert C. Ada Gym conference room as the league will review and adopt the ground rules and discuss other technical matters for the upcoming season. He reminded all teams to secure their respective sponsors and acquired their complete uniforms.

Waiver forms are already available at the NMSA office inside the Ada Gym and they will also be distributed in the meeting.
